Question
Hafez Sahib of our mosque announced during Tarabi that there is prostration in the first rak'ah. But he forgot the verse before he reached the verse of prostration. Since he has declared prostration, he has prostrated without reciting the verses of prostration. Then he recited from another verse and finished the prayer and Sahu did not prostrate. The question is, has our prayer been valid or not? 3685169568
Answer
- حامداومصلياومسلما، بسم الله الرحمن الرحيم -
Intentional prostration without reciting the verses of prostration is a sin. However, this will not break the prayer; Rather, everyone's prayers have been performed. The Imam should repent to Allah for his mistake. 6155451423
